Assembles metal products, such as sprinkler frames of all types, partially or completely. Testing of assembled sprinkler frames, inspecting and packaging. Working in a cell environment on shop floor by performing the following duties.
RESPONSIBILITIES:
- Positions parts according to knowledge of unit being assembled or following blueprints.
- Fastens parts together with screws and adhesives.
- Removes small quantities of metal shavings with air or small brush to produce a proper seal between parts.
- Operates drill presses, small air toggle presses, hand semi-automatic assemblers, solder applicators or riveting machines to assist in assembly operation.
- Tests sprinklers according to approval laboratory guide lines.
- Inspects and packages sprinklers according to Viking quality standards.
- Disassembles sprinklers and its components for salvage of parts.
- Identifies scrap and salvage and records such for inventory purposes.
- Operates forklift in order to pick orders or receive in stock. Completes daily lift equipment inspections. Uses forklift to load and unload pipe and other material from flat bed and/or box type trailers.
- Pick orders by utilizing RF technology and/or by identifying items on a paper pick ticket according to bin location, part number, and/or description.
